It is my local Italian, but I just love it to bits…read more Nestled down an alley behind two huge wooden doors (thus the name), the restaurant has a great layout. In warm weather the alley has tables that allow outside seating. Inside, the downstairs isn't huge, which gives it a close, cosy feel. There are tables for 2, 4 and a couple of larger ones (one rectangular, one circular). There's lots of extra seating upstairs, although the ambiance isn't quite as nice. It's run by Italians, so you get the proper bread and olives to start. Now, I've eaten olives all over the world, but I have no idea where these guys get olives this tasty. I've gone just for the olives. The menu's got lots of choice: starters, pasta, several pizzas, and some great mains. I wouldn't say it's the best place I've ever eaten, but it is the most consistent to have very good quality food. We go at least once a month, and have never been disappointed. Wine list is okay, but I always get the Valpolicella. Service is friendly and accommodating. They'll do your pizza take-away if you like.
